M-MAC: Motion Sensor Assisted MAC Protocol for Body Area Network with Periodical Movement.
Abstract
When a person is performing repetitive daily activities (e.g. walking, cycling etc.) with equipped motion sensor such as accelerometer, its measured motion signals can go up or down and fluctuates in a periodical manner. In addition, recent researches indicate that the Received Signal Strength (RSS) through wireless channels between on-body sensors and the hub in a Wireless Body Area Network (WBAN) also shares a similar periodical pattern regards to the same body movement. Finding the connections of the two, can enable low-power tracking of body movement and infer corresponding channel changes to provide optimized MAC communications between sensor nodes and the hub. However, since nodes can be placed at different parts of the body experiencing different motion intensities and velocities, it is not straightforward to directly map the motion sensor measurements to the Channel RSS. In this paper, we proposed the notion of motion index which is an effective mechanism to achieve synchronization between the channel periodicity and the corresponding body motion. The proposed M-MAC protocol then reacts to such WBAN channel periodicity and gives high medium access priority to sensors with good channel condition hence increases communication reliability, while buffering data otherwise. We conducted experiments based on real-life on-body channel measurements, and our initial results yield promising results with 10% - 20% PDR increase and 3 dB transmitting power reduction compared to the conventional methods.
